package main
import (
"bytes"
"context"
"fmt"
"io/ioutil"
"net/http"
"net/url"
"os"
"time"
"github.com/Azure/azure-storage-blob-go/azblob"
)
var azMediaCont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L
func azureErrorCode(err error) (string, error) {
if err != nil {
if serr, ok := err.(azblob.StorageError); ok { // This error is an Azure Service-specific
return string(serr.ServiceCode()), nil
}
return err.Error(), fmt.Errorf("Not an azblob error -> return original error string")
}
return "", fmt.Errorf("Original error is nil")
}
func azureStorageInit(sc *ServerConfig) (*azblob.ContainerURL, error) {
// config check
if len(sc.AzureStorageAccount) == 0 || len(sc.AzureStorageAccessKey) == 0 {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("Invalid azure storage account name or access key")
}
// create a default request pipeline using storage account name and account key.
credential, credentailErr := azblob.NewSharedKeyCredential(sc.AzureStorageAccount, sc.AzureStorageAccessKey)
if credentailErr !=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("Invalid azure credentials with error: %s", credentailErr.Error())
}
pipeline := azblob.NewPipeline(credential, azblob.PipelineOptions{})
// from the Azure portal, get storage account blob service URL endpoint.
URL, _ := url.Parse(
fmt.Sprintf("https://%s.blob.core.windows.net/%s", sc.AzureStorageAccount, sc.AzureStorageContainer))
// create a ContainerURL object that wraps the container URL and a request pipeline to make requests.
containerURL := azblob.NewContainerURL(*URL, pipeline)
// check if container exists. If not, try to create
if _, containerPropErr := containerURL.GetProperties(context.TODO(), azblob.LeaseAccessConditions{}); containerPropErr != nil {
if serr, ok := containerPropErr.(azblob.StorageError); ok && serr.ServiceCode() == azblob.ServiceCodeContainerNotFound {
if containerCreateErr := azureStorageCreateContainer(&containerURL); containerCreateErr != nil {
return nil, containerCreateErr
}
} else {
return nil, containerPropErr
}
}
return &containerURL, nil
}
func azureStorageCreateContainer(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L) error {
if azureContainerURL == n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Empty azure container URL object")
}
// create azure storage container
if _, containerCreateErr := azureContainerURL.Create(context.TODO(), azblob.Metadata{}, azblob.PublicAccessBlob); containerCreateErr != nil {
return containerCreateErr
}
return nil
}
func azureStorageDeleteContainer(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L) error {
if azureContainerURL == n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Empty azure container URL object")
}
// delete azure storage container
if _, containerDeleteErr := azureContainerURL.Delete(context.TODO(), azblob.ContainerAccessConditions{}); containerDeleteErr != nil {
return containerDeleteErr
}
return nil
}
func azureStorageListBlobs(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L, prefix string) ([]*azblob.BlobItem, error) {
if azureContainerURL == nil {
return []*azblob.BlobItem{}, fmt.Errorf("Empty azure container URL object")
}
var blobItems = []*azblob.BlobItem{}
for marker := (azblob.Marker{}); marker.NotDone(); {
// get a result segment starting with the blob indicated by the current Marker.
listBlob, listBlobErr := azureContainerURL.ListBlobsFlatSegment(context.TODO(), marker, azblob.ListBlobsSegmentOptions{
Prefix: prefix,
})
if listBlobErr != nil {
return []*azblob.BlobItem{}, listBlobErr
}
// append blobs to results
for bi := range listBlob.Segment.BlobItems {
blobItems = append(blobItems, &listBlob.Segment.BlobItems[bi])
}
// update marker
marker = listBlob.NextMarker
}
return blobItems, nil
}
func azureStorageBlobExist(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L, blobname string) (bool, error) {
blobURL := azureContainerURL.NewBlobURL(blobname)
_, err := blobURL.GetProperties(context.TODO(), azblob.BlobAccessConditions{})
if err != nil {
if serr, ok := err.(azblob.StorageError); ok && serr.ServiceCode() == azblob.ServiceCodeBlobNotFound {
return false, nil
}
return false, err
}
return true, nil
}
func azureStorageGetBlobProperties(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L, blobname string) (*AzureBlobProp, error) {
blobURL := azureContainerURL.NewBlobURL(blobname)
blobPropResp, err := blobURL.GetProperties(context.TODO(), azblob.BlobAccessConditions{})
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if blobPropResp == nil || blobPropResp.Response().StatusCode != http.StatusOK {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("[%s] - no blob properties response received", serverErrorMessages[seCloudOpsError])
}
var azureBlobProp AzureBlobProp
azureBlobProp.BlobName = blobname
azureBlobProp.CreateTS = 0
if createTimeString, ok := blobPropResp.Response().Header["Last-Modified"]; ok && len(createTimeString) > 0 {
if timestamp, timpErr := time.Parse(time.RFC1123, createTimeString[0]); timpErr == nil {
azureBlobProp.CreateTS = int64(timestamp.Unix())
}
}
azureBlobProp.ContentLength = blobPropResp.Response().ContentLength
return &azureBlobProp, nil
}
func azureStorageUploadBlob(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L, blobname string) error {
if azureContainerURL == n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Empty azure container URL object")
}
// read blob file
blobFile, fileErr := os.Open(blobname)
if fileErr !=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Failed to open file %s for blob upload", blobname)
}
defer blobFile.Close()
// upload blob file
blobURL := azureContainerURL.NewBlockBlobURL(blobname)
_, blobUploadErr := azblob.UploadFileToBlockBlob(context.TODO(), blobFile, blobURL, azblob.UploadToBlockBlobOptions{
BlockSize: 4 * 1024 * 1024,
Parallelism: 16})
if blobUploadErr != nil {
return blobUploadErr
}
return nil
}
func azureStorageDownloadBlob(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L, blobname string) error {
if azureContainerURL == n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Empty azure container URL object")
}
// download blob file
blobURL := azureContainerURL.NewBlockBlobURL(blobname)
downloadResp, downloadErr := blobURL.Download(context.TODO(), 0, azblob.CountToEnd, azblob.BlobAccessConditions{}, false)
if downloadErr != nil {
return downloadErr
}
bodyStream := downloadResp.Body(azblob.RetryReaderOptions{MaxRetryRequests: 5})
downloadedData := bytes.Buffer{}
_, dataErr := downloadedData.ReadFrom(bodyStream)
if dataErr !=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Failed to read downloaded blob data: %s", dataErr.Error())
}
// save blob file
fileErr := ioutil.WriteFile(blobname, downloadedData.Bytes(), 0755)
if fileErr !=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Failed to save blob file %s: %s", blobname, fileErr.Error())
}
return nil
}
func azureStorageDeleteBlob(azureContainerURL *azblob.ContainerURL, blobname string) error {
if azureContainerURL == nil {
return fmt.Errorf("Empty azure container URL object")
}
// delete blob
blobURL := azureContainerURL.NewBlockBlobURL(blobname)
_, deleteErr := blobURL.Delete(context.TODO(), azblob.DeleteSnapshotsOptionInclude, azblob.BlobAccessConditions{})
if deleteErr != nil {
return deleteErr
}
return nil
}
